Dear Stockholder:

As you are aware, the Board of Directors of DIH Holding US, Inc. (the "Company," "we," or "our") has called a Special Meeting of Stockholders (the "Special Meeting") which will be held on September 25, 2025 at 11:00 A.M. Eastern Time, or at any adjournment or postponement thereof.

The information in this letter is intended to supplement and amend certain information included in the definitive proxy statement relating to the Special Meeting, which was fil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ission on August 26, 2025 (the "Proxy Statement").

Quorum Requirement

The purpose of this letter is to provide new information about the quorum requirement for the Special Meeting. On September 10, 2025, our Board of Directors adopted resolutions to amend our Bylaws to provide that the holders of 33 1/3% of the outstanding shares of Common Stock will constitute a quorum at all meetings of our stockholders for the transaction of business (the "Bylaw Amendment"), including at the Special Meeting. Our Bylaws previously provided that the holders of a majority of the outstanding shares of stock constituted a quorum at all meetings of our stockholders for the transaction of business. By reducing the quorum requirement from a majority of outstanding stock to 33 1/3% of outstanding stock, we are more likely to reach quorum and hold a valid stockholders meeting. In particular, our Board of Directors believes that there are important proposals to be considered by stockholders at the Special Meeting including, but not limited to, the consideration of a reverse stock split. If a quorum cannot be obtained, no action can be taken on these matters and the Company would be obligated to incur the expense of calling and holding another meeting of its stockholders. Moreover, the Board believes that the new quorum requirement is high enough to ensure that a broad range of stockholders are represented at meetings, while also reducing the risk of the Company needing to adjourn such meetings.

Impact of the Quorum Change on Voting at the Special Meeting

The approval of each of the Proposals requires the affirmative vote of a majority of the votes cast on the matter. As a result of the Bylaw Amendment, fewer outstanding shares of stock will be required to constitute a quorum at the Special Meeting. This means that, if the number of shares represented at the Special Meeting satisfies the new quorum requirement but is less than a majority of our outstanding shares of stock, the affirmative vote of fewer shares will be required to approve each of the Proposals than if the Bylaw Amendment had not been approved.
